Top 5 Best La Puente High Schools (2025)

For the 2025 school year, there are 8 public high schools serving 4,280 students in La Puente, CA.
The top ranked public high schools in La Puente, CA are William Workman High School, Bassett Senior High School and Nogales High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
La Puente, CA public high schools have an average math proficiency score of 16% (versus the California public high school average of 28%), and reading proficiency score of 47% (versus the 51% statewide average). High schools in La Puente have an average ranking of 4/10, which is in the bottom 50% of California public high schools.
La Puente, CA public high school have a Graduation Rate of 95%, which is more than the California average of 87%.
The school with highest graduation rate is La Puente High School, with ≥99%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in California or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 99%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the California public high school average of 79% (majority Hispanic).
